About the team
The Search and Conversational Shopping (Rufus) team at Amazon represents the state of the art of AI-driven product discovery. We operate at an unprecedented scale, serving billions of search queries daily worldwide. Our team combines deep scientific expertise with a relentless focus on customer experience, developing technologies that make finding products more natural, intuitive, and engaging.
We work across multiple domains, from e-commerce and cloud services to entertainment and devices, creating search experience that adapt to diverse user needs. Our team collaborates closely with other Amazon AI organizations, including AWS AI Services, Alexa, and Artificial General Intelligence, creating a rich ecosystem of technological innovation.

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several US geographic markets. The base pay for this position ranges from $262,500/year in our lowest geographic market up to $350,000/year in our highest geographic market. Pay is based on a number of factors including market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Amazon is a total compensation company. Dependent on the position offered, equity, sign-on payments, and other forms of compensation may be provided as part of a total compensation package, in addition to a full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
